Linux文件系统与Windows比较:两者文件系统有什么区别?

时间:2025-12-15 分类:操作系统

Linux和Windows是目前最流行的两种操作系统,各自拥有自己的文件系统。在这两者之间,文件管理和存储机制存在显著差异。这些差异自然会影响用户的使用体验、数据处理能力以及系统的安全性。理解这些区别对计算机用户、开发者以及系统管理员而言,都至关重要。本文将深入探讨Linux与Windows文件系统的不同之处,包括结构、权限管理、性能等方面,帮助读者更好地选择适合自己需求的操作系统。

Linux文件系统与Windows比较:两者文件系统有什么区别?

Linux文件系统采用的是分层结构,通常以根目录(/)开头,然后逐级向下延伸。每个设备(比如硬盘、USB驱动器)都会被挂载到某个目录中,从而形成统一的目录结构。这种设计理念提高了文件管理的灵活性。而Windows文件系统则基于驱动器字母(如C盘、D盘等)的概念,每个驱动器是独立存储的。这种方式使得Windows用户容易理解自己的存储配置,但在管理多设备时可能显得不够方便。

权限管理是Linux和Windows文件系统体现出的另一重要差异。在Linux中,文件的访问权限通过用户、组和其他三者进行细分,用户可以轻松管理谁能够读取、写入或执行特定文件。这种明确的权限机制在多用户环境中增强了系统的安全性。相比之下,Windows则采用用户账户控制(UAC)来管理权限,虽然提供了图形化界面进行操作,但在灵活性和精细化管理上不及Linux。

在性能方面,Linux文件系统(如ext4、XFS等)通常在处理大文件和大量小文件时表现优异,尤其在服务器环境中的稳定性和效率备受认可。Windows的NTFS文件系统也具备良好的性能,尤其在图形界面操作和用户友好性上更具优势。当涉及到大规模数据处理时,Linux常常能够提供更高的吞吐量和更少的资源占用。

文件系统的兼容性是两个操作系统之间的另一显著区别。Linux支持多种文件系统,如ext2、ext3、Btrfs等,允许用户根据需求选择最适合的格式。而Windows主要使用NTFS和FAT32,尽管NTFS在功能上更为强大,但对Linux的支持相对有限,这可能在跨平台文件分享时带来不便。

Linux与Windows在文件系统设计、权限管理、性能表现及兼容性等方面各有千秋,理解这些区别不仅有助于用户根据自身需求选择操作系统,也为系统管理员的日常管理提供了参考依据。无论是进行文件管理还是执行复杂的任务,选择合适的文件系统都是提升工作效率的关键。